Heat treatment for bed bugs is an environmentally friendly, chemical-free solution that uses regulated high temperatures to remove all life phases of bed bugs, consisting of eggs. The procedure includes raising the temperature of infested rooms or structures to levels lethal to bed bugs, normally between 120 ° F and 140 ° F, for numerous hours. Heat permeates furnishings, walls, and mattresses, getting rid of pests in hard-to-reach places. This treatment is safe for most household items and supplies immediate results, reducing the requirement for chemical applications. Post-treatment tracking makes sure complete elimination and avoids reinfestation.
